About
North East Westchester Special Recreation, Inc. offers community-based therapeutic recreation programs that include bowling, volleyball, basketball, floor hockey, softball, track and field, aquatics, crafts, games, cooking activities, music, art, movement, gym activities, travel, leisure activities, education, day trips, and a Summer Day Camp. Summer Day Camp activities include art, outdoor games, music, gym, hobbies, horticulture, outdoor crafts, fitness, swimming, and field trips. The program also offers Special Olympics softball, Concerts In The Park, and the Frost Valley Vacation Program.
• Ages: 4–18 years old
• Schedule: General office hours Monday–Friday, 8:30am–4:30pm; Summer Day Camp runs for six weeks for ages 4–21
North East Westchester Special Recreation, Inc. was incorporated in 1981 as a community-based therapeutic recreation program for children, teens, and adults with developmental disabilities residing in Westchester County, New York. The organization’s mission states that it strives to provide community-based therapeutic recreation programs that enhance the physical, cognitive, emotional, and social functioning of children, teens, and adults with developmental disabilities and to provide confidence-building experiences that foster and cultivate meaningful relationships. The North East Westchester Special Recreation Consortium is a non-profit 501(c)(3) organization operating under the auspices of the New York State Office for People with Developmental Disabilities as a certified respite provider and is described as the second largest agency of its kind in the State of New York, with local and state-wide attention for the quality and novelty of its programs and services.
Programs are described as being designed with specific support needed for participant success in community recreational environments, and include Special Olympics training in multiple sports, including softball, with opportunities to advance to area, sectional, and state level competition. Weekend and overnight options such as Weekends Away and the Frost Valley Vacation Program offer additional recreation experiences, including a five-day vacation in the Catskills for adults. Adults in the program also attend weekly concerts to interact with local residents and enjoy a variety of entertainment.
The leadership team includes Executive Director Ellie Arnemann; Program Director Nancy Bellini, CTRS; Program Coordinator/Summer Camp Director Joe Bellini; Recreation Therapist Jocelyn Aquino; Senior Recreation Therapist Jessie Espinet, CTRS; and Office Manager Jennifer Debiec. Staff credentials noted include that Nancy Bellini is a Certified Therapeutic Recreation Specialist and that Jessie Espinet earned her Certification in Therapeutic Recreation. The North East Westchester Special Recreation Consortium is led by a Board of Directors made up of Recreation Superintendents from twelve participating communities in the northeast portion of Westchester County, New York.
